Is it possible to detect if a question is duplicate, when the question is asking about a picture? For example, if I stick a picture onto the question and ask "what is this", is there any way for me to check if that question is a duplicate? If there is, what is the method? If there is not, then it will be very inconvenient. The picture question may result in a duplicate close and if I ask a lot of picture questions, then I will be banned for asking too much duplicate questions!

Not possible to search for a pic with advanced search or dupe search (while asking, below the title).

You can try google search by image:

https://www.google.com/searchbyimage?image_url={your-image-url}?&q=site:somesite.stackexchange.com

{your-image-url} would be image you want to find;
somesite.stackexchange.com - replace it with some SE site you want to search on.
